Kaiser Kuo, host of the Sinica podcast and an authority on US-China relations, shares insights into China's rapid technological advancements. He explains how President Xi Jinping's directives influence researchers and businesses, creating a unique drive for innovation. The discussion highlights key projects like DeepSeek's AI model that challenge American tech dominance. Kuo contrasts China's optimistic view on technology with America's anxieties, exploring the cultural and political factors that propel China's tech sector forward.

China's Rapid Yet Incomplete Growth

  • China's rapid transformation is like a child mind in an adult body, evolving fast materially but slower mentally.
  • Expecting China to behave like a fully mature country overlooks this cultural and developmental gap.

Tech Optimism Vs. Tech Anxiety

  • Chinese culture views technology as a practical benefit rather than an existential threat.
  • This leads to greater techno-optimism and less fear compared to many American and Western perspectives.

Parents Steer Kids Toward Practical Tech

  • Chinese parents pressure children to excel in practical technical fields, discouraging distractions like gaming.
  • This cultural norm aligns with national priorities of directing talent toward productive industries.
